What is Friture?

Friture is an open-source application for real-time audio analysis on Linux. It provides a wide range of visualization tools to give detailed insights into audio input from a microphone or sound device.

Some of the key features of Friture include:

  • Real-time fast Fourier transform (FFT) spectrum analyzer
  • Spectrogram with logarithmic frequency scale
  • Rolling 2D spectrogram to visualize how frequencies change over time
  • Octave analysis to inspect frequency content in different octave bands
  • Scope, histogram and correlation meters

Friture is written in Python and uses PyQt and NumPy libraries. It works on any Linux distribution and supports ALSA or JACK audio backends. The visualizations provide a detailed overview of the amplitude, frequencies and spectral content of audio. This makes Friture useful for tasks like tuning musical instruments, analyzing room acoustics, testing audio equipment and more.

As an open-source tool, Friture is completely free to download and use. It provides powerful audio analysis capabilities without the need for expensive specialized hardware or software.
